Question:
I have a question on bearing block kits for Schwintek slide. What is the difference between standard and composite bearing block kits? One of the shoes sheared off an upper bearing block so I need to replace that bearing block. I have a 2018 Grand Design Imagine 2800BH. Just trying to verify all the correct items I need to replace that upper bearing block. Thank you!
asked by: Andrew M
Expert Reply:
Hello Andrew, good question. Basically the only difference between the composite kits and the standard (non-composite) kits is the application they are used for. Composite are used in motorhomes, the other are used on towable campers. It has to do with movement of the RV when traveling. The non-composite can be made of aluminum or a combination of materials.
Composite bearing blocks must be replaced with composite blocks, and non-composite must be replaced with non-composite. You can't switch between the two.
Since you have a travel trailer, you will want to use the standard block # LC379060.
